Boosting the Electrical power point out of the atom’s nucleus employing a laser, or exciting it, would allow the event of probably the most accurate atomic clocks at any time to exist and permit quite possibly the most exact measurements of your time and gravity. These an atomic clock could even rewrite several of the basic legislation of physics.
Essentially, Of course. "Atom" originates from greek "atomos" = "uncuttable", and is Utilized in the perception "indivisible smallest device" for an exceedingly while (till physicists discovered that, in truth, you will find
Atomic assures that usage of the assets will be done in an atomic fashion. E.g. it constantly return a fully initialised objects, any get/list of a property on a person thread have to total before Yet another can entry it.
And positive sufficient in 1970 Codd suggests "phrases attribute and repeating team in current databases terminology are approximately analogous to easy area and nonsimple domain, respectively".)
Atomic doesn't assurance thread protection, however It is handy for attaining thread basic safety. Thread Security is relative to the way you write your code/ which thread queue that you are examining/composing from. It only assures non-crashable multithreading. What?! Are multithreading and thread security distinctive?
realtion. While Codd utilised day-to-day "nonatomic" to introduce defining relational "nonatomic" as relation-valued and outlined "normalized" as freed from relation-valued domains.
Essentially, the atomic version needs to take a lock in order to guarantee thread protection, in addition to is bumping the ref depend on the article (plus the autorelease depend to harmony it) so that the article is certain to exist for that caller, normally There's a potential race condition if A different thread is location the value, causing the Atomic ref depend to drop to 0.
I did not wish to pollute world namespace with 'id', so I set it like a static in the functionality; even so in that case it's essential to Make certain that on your System that does not bring about actual initialization code.
We created this valuable manual to teach you anything you will need about obtaining a Bitcoin Wallet app and storing your digital gold. You will also get pleasure from an in depth manual on a particular wallet, Atomic Wallet, which delivers helpful characteristics like sending and obtaining, staking, and exchange.
Additionally you need to have it to reactivate your wallet in your new telephone. Still, you need to delete your wallet from a outdated cellphone and wipe the information off once It is really all migrated on your new machine.
What stops A different Main from accessing the memory deal with following the 1st has fetched it but before it sets the new benefit? Does the memory controller handle this?
It is best to use the proper technology for your requirements, uses, and abilities. Hopefully this will preserve you a handful of hours of comparisons, and make it easier to make a better informed determination when building your plans.
It is like using a retina Display screen and another Show at fifty situations the resolution. Why waste the sources to obtain that amount of general performance if it makes no variation to anyone? Particularly when strong code can preserve times of debugging...
Safety begins with understanding how developers accumulate and share your information. Facts privateness and safety techniques may fluctuate dependant on your use, region, and age. The developer presented this information and facts and will update it after a while.